In 1939 the second world war started, it was mainly England v Germany. Germany wanted more land so they started the war. Then Germans came and started to bomb England.
So England started to black out all of the windows at night with heavy curtains and blinds, so as not to present any target to passing German bombers. Street lamps and even vehicle head-lamps were forbidden and special wardens patrolled the street to make sure everyone complied.
